Alice is a farmer who lives in a remote ranch in Texas. She has chosen to improve the way she monitors her corn field. She wants to install wireless sensors to monitor her crops, and collect environmental data. She has a good understanding of electronics, and has decided to design her own sensors and communication infrastructure based on off-the-shelf products.
Suppose Alice purchases wireless sensor nodes with a maximum transmit power of -5dBm and sensitivity of -90dBm. Assume that the propagation loss model is log-distance with a path loss exponent of 3 and path loss at 1m is 25dB. She wants ensure that there is at least one sensor within 50m of every sensor. Her field is 1000m X 1000m in area. 3.1 How many nodes would she need to purchase such that they can form a network and satisfy her sensing requirement? 3.2 If 5% of those nodes fail, can her network become disconnected? 3.3 How can you ensure that the network remains connected if 10% of the nodes fail?
Alice’s house adjoins a barn with some animals. The barn then adjoins her corn field. The distance between her house and the field is 500m. She installs the wireless sensor nodes from problem 4 on the animals in the barn to monitor them. How can she collect data from her crops if she places the collection point in her house? How can she leverage the sensors on the animals to “mule” data from the crops?
